What is Natural Progesterone?

The human body produces many natural hormones. Natural progesterone is one of such natural hormones of our body. It remains both in men and women. But, nowadays, scientists make this hormone in laboratories.

Natural progesterone

What are the Functions of Natural Progesterone?

Progesterone is a sex hormone. It performs many functions in our body. Some of them are-

  1. The hormone’s levels go ups and downs with menstrual periods of women. Again, the levels contribute to notice menstrual symptoms.
  2. It helps to thick the lining of the uterus, fertilizes the eggs. Thus the uterus becomes ready for pregnancy.
  3. If the muscles of the uterus are tight, women’s bodies reject the eggs. Progesterone prevents the contractions of muscles.
  4. The hormone also prevents ovulation of another egg.
  5. In a male body, this hormone balances the effects of estrogen. The adrenal glands and testes make progesterone in the male’s body.
  6. People also use the lab-made progesterone to get the same results. 

 

What are the Symptoms of low Natural Progesterone Level?

The hormones become low with age in the human body. Menopause hormones play a vital role in balancing women’s bodies for their general health. Low levels of progesterone have many adverse effects, such as-

  • Irregular periods
  • Missed or delay periods
  • Low sex demand
  • Crumping during periods and pregnancy
  • Miscarriage
  • Infertility
  • Sudden weight gain

What is lab-made Natural Progesterone?

We call the lab-made natural progesterone as ‘Progestin.’ It has all quality of progesterone hormone. Pharmacists use wild yam and soy to make diosgenin. After that, pharmacists convert it into progestin in the laboratory. This progesterone has the same bioidentical benefits as a woman’s body shapes. Is it safe to use Natural Progesterone Products?

The modern medical system and inventions are fantastic for any disease treatment. But, still today, there are some limitations and threats. When any patient shows interest in therapy for hormones, they must study well. They should not forget to consult with a doctor before using any product. The side effects of natural progesterone products are-

  • Headaches
  • Skin allergies
  • Stomach problems
  • Depressions
  • Breast tenderness
  • Blurry vision
  • Sudden weight gain etc.

Who must avoid Natural Progesterone?

There are many patients with different problems around us. Without tests and prescriptions from doctors, no one should use progesterone. People with below diseases should avoid it-

  • Cancer
  • Severe allergic problems
  • Major depression
  • Liver disease
  • Arterial disease
  • Unknown vaginal bleeding

Natural progesterone may also raise some risks—for example- heart problems, breast cancer, stroke, etc. 

Do Changes in Lifestyle matter to raise the Natural Progesterone level?

There are many natural ways to increase natural progesterone levels in the body. Everybody should follow a healthy lifestyle for that. Some necessary and natural regulations to maintain are-

Healthy Diet Chart:

Healthy foods are necessary for people of all ages. We can easily find foods rich in minerals and nutrients. Again, these foods are not costly. These help to grow natural progesterone and balance our hormones.

Healthy Exercise:

Regular physical exercises are to maintain sound health. It helps for proper blood circulation and increase progesterone level naturally. But, we have to keep in mind that over-exercise is not good at all. It can release stress hormones that have adverse effects. 

Acupuncture:

Some studies say that this process may reduce pregnancy losses. Before getting pregnant, women can consult their doctors about this method. They may then apply it to balance hormones.

Healthy Body Weight:

Excess body fats occur hormonal imbalances in our body. Again, it prevents raising the natural progesterone level. In opposite, it may produce extra estrogen too. So, everyone should maintain a bodyweight according to their age and height. 

Stay Stress-Free:

Relaxing is essential to balance hormonal levels. Tensions, stresses, depressions are not ethical, especially for female hormones. We can do yoga, meditation to stay stress-free. Besides, entertainments, leisure times, cares of the family are equally important things.
